Crispy Chilli Beef with Sweet Chilli: A Flavor Explosion
Ingredients
Scale
- 200 g Rump/Sirloin steak
- 1 large Egg
- 1 cup Corn/Potato Starch
- 0.5 Sweet Onion
- 0.5 Bell Pepper
- 2–3 Spring Onions
- 2–3 Birdeye/hot chillies
- 1 tbsp Light soy sauce
- 1 tsp Ginger garlic paste
- 1 tsp Sesame oil
- 0.5 tsp Sugar
- 0.25 tsp White Pepper
- 3 tbsp Sweet Chilli Sauce
- 2 tbsp Ketchup
- 2 tbsp Light soy sauce
- 1 tsp Vinegar (white or rice)
- 1 tbsp Sugar
- 0.5 tsp Salt
Instructions
- Slice the beef into thin strips and marinate with the marinade ingredients for at least 15 minutes.
- Combine all the stir fry sauce ingredients in a bowl and whisk until smooth, then set aside.
- Incorporate the egg into the marinated beef strips to bind the coating.
- Coat the beef strips evenly with corn or potato starch, separating the pieces well.
- Heat oil in a pan until it reaches about 350°F. Deep fry the coated beef strips for 1-2 minutes until golden and crispy.
- Drain the fried beef on paper towels to remove excess oil.
- Sauté the onions in a preheated wok or pan with oil for a few seconds, then add bell pepper slices.
- Mix in the crispy beef strips and pour in the prepared sauce, adding spring onions and fresh chillies.
- Plate the dish and serve immediately.
Notes
- Adjust the number of chillies based on your spice tolerance.
- Use any tender steak cut for best results.
